Need help planning a trip to Germany

Hi,



I have a 1 week vacation in June that I would like to spend on a relatively inexpensive European vacation (I live in the US)



1. Having been to Paris, I thought Germany would be a good destination. Is June a good time to visit? How expensive are the hotels there, and how difficult is it to travel around?



I%26#39;m interested in general sightseeing, historical places, great architecture, and some museums. Am not particularly interested in shopping, or cuisine.





If I land in Frankfurt, how expensive will it be for me to travel around to Berlin and Munich?





Can I get cheap and safe hotels in either of these cities for about $100 a night or less?





Can someone suggest orther European destinations that might be as good / better idea?





Other possible destinations outside Europe?





Thanks.

%26quot;I have a 1 week vacation in June that I would like to spend on a relatively inexpensive European vacation (I live in the US)%26quot;



You can easily spend your entire week vacation in one city in Germany and its nearby surroundings and have plenty of excellent things that you did not have time to visit.





%26quot;I thought Germany would be a good destination. Is June a good time to visit?%26quot;



June is an excellent time to visit Germany. The weather will be warm. There will many more tourists later in the summer.





%26quot;how difficult is it to travel around?%26quot;



Germany has excellent public transportation in and near large cities, and fair public transportation in more rural areas.





%26quot;Can I get cheap and safe hotels in either of these cities for about $100 a night or less?%26quot;



You should be able to find some hotels near the city center within this price range, and the further you go out from the center the hotels will usually get less expensive. There are also youth hostels, no matter what your age in most places in Germany.





%26quot; Can someone suggest orther European destinations that might be as good / better idea?%26quot;



You could visit my favorite European city, Istanbul. There is easily more than enough fascinating sights and things to do for over a week, and it is inexpensive.





%26quot;Other possible destinations outside Europe?%26quot;



Morocco is fascinating. Try Fez or Marrakech.
